Southbury station provides several amenities to enhance your travel experience. Ticket purchasing is streamlined with the availability of ticket machines, and collecting tickets is a breeze as you can collect those bought online directly from the machines. The station is equipped with an induction loop and accessible ticket machines, ensuring that passengers with different needs are catered to. While the station itself does not issue Smartcards or validate them, it does ensure the presence of staff help from Monday to Saturday, enhancing your journey with friendly assistance.
If you’re into cycling, Southbury has got you covered with 8 Sheffield stand spaces under CCTV surveillance, although there is no shelter available for bicycle storage. Refreshments are at your disposal with both cold drinks and food vending machines, making that quick snack available any time you need it.
While the station lacks some amenities such as waiting rooms, toilets, or even an ATM, it compensates with step-free access throughout the premises, ensuring ease of movement for wheelchair users and those with mobility impairments. With customer help points and helpful Departure and Arrival screens, the transition to your next train should be a seamless affair.
The transport connections available at Southbury station take care of all your onward travel needs. If you're needing a bus, Transport for London buses operate from right outside the station. For bigger journeys or if rail services are temporarily unavailable, rail replacement services are on hand, and you can find them at Bus stops S and B on Southbury Road, serving northward and southward directions respectively. Shirehampton train station is a minimalist stop in terms of amenities, focusing on straightforward accessibility. There isn't a ticket office or machine, so travelers need to buy and retrieve tickets by alternative means such as online booking. Despite the absence of physical ticketing infrastructure, the station does feature departure screens and a help point for any immediate travel inquiries.
Accessibility is a key feature, with step-free access throughout the station, ensuring a seamless experience for those with reduced mobility. However, travelers should note the lack of waiting rooms, restrooms, and refreshment facilities on the premises. Still, the station extends a warm welcome with available seating areas and customer help points to assist passengers.
When it comes to connectivity, Shirehampton station integrates multiple modes of transport to ease your onward journey. While taxi services aren't available directly at the station, travelers can find taxis on the station approach road. The nearby bus laybys on A4 Portway by the footbridge serve as pivotal spots for rail replacement services, should the need arise. For cyclists, bike storage facilities are conveniently located at the station entrance and on the platform, although there is no covered or secured area.
